LAHORE, May 6: Punjab Housing and Urban Development Minister Syed Raza Ali Gilani has ordered auction of all vacant plots in housing schemes and expediting the arrears recovery campaign. Presiding over a departmental meeting here on Friday, the minister said that vacant plots should be auctioned in a transparent manner.

He said there was no justification for keeping the plots developed for providing residential facilities to the people.

He also ordered presentation of a detailed report in respect of the arrears recovery from allottees of plots in a fortnight.

Assistance: The Punjab Baitul Maal has provided financial assistance of Rs70 million to 16,070 needy people directly and Rs44 million to district baitul maal committees for helping the poor during the last six months.

This was disclosed during a meeting held here on Friday to review the progress of distribution of the Baitul Maal funds. Provincial Baitul Maal Minister Chaudhry Muhammad Ijaz Shafi presided.

The minister was informed that rates of grants for dowry, educational stipend and medical treatment had been doubled this year and the Baitul Maal funds would be tripled next year for providing financial assistance to scores of deserving people.
